Latitude and longitude of Cairo,Egypt provide the precise geographic location that defines this historic metropolis on the world map. Situated on the banks of the Nile River, Cairo’s coordinates are 30.0444° N latitude and 31.2357° E longitude. These figures place the capital of Egypt in the Northern Hemisphere and the Eastern Hemisphere, positioning it at a crossroads of cultures, trade routes, and ancient civilizations. Geographic Coordinates Overview
What Do Latitude and Longitude Mean?
- Latitude measures how far north or south a point is from the Equator, expressed in degrees, minutes, and seconds. - Longitude measures how far east or west a location is from the Prime Meridian (0°), also expressed in degrees, minutes, and seconds.
Together, they form a global grid that enables accurate pinpointing of any place on Earth.
How Are These Numbers Determined?
- Satellite Observation – Modern GPS and satellite imagery provide the most precise measurements.
- Astronomical Methods – Historically, navigators used the position of the sun, stars, and the angle of the horizon.
- Geodetic Surveys – Ground‑based triangulation and datum adjustments refine the coordinates over time.
The current official coordinates for Cairo are recorded by the Egyptian Survey Authority and are widely accepted by cartographic services worldwide Which is the point..
Exact Coordinates of Cairo
- Decimal Degrees: 30.0444° N, 31.2357° E
- Degrees, Minutes, Seconds (DMS): 30° 02′ 40″ N, 31° 14′ 08″ E These numbers can be entered into any GPS device, mapping application, or smartphone to locate the heart of Cairo. Here's one way to look at it: typing “30.0444, 31.2357” into a search bar will drop a pin directly on the city’s central district, near Tahrir Square.

Common Misconceptions
- “Cairo is on the Equator.”
- Incorrect. Cairo’s latitude is 30° N, well above the Equator (0°).
- “All coordinates are the same worldwide.”
- False. Each location has a unique pair of latitude and longitude; even nearby landmarks can differ by a few meters. 3. “Coordinates never change.”
- Not entirely true. Over centuries, tectonic movements and datum revisions can shift coordinates by a small margin.
